King Cobb Steelie – Junior Relaxer – Review

King Cobb Steelie

Junior Relaxer (Nettwerk)
by Malcolm E

Another live band trying to slip into the warm-up suit of the mellowed-out raver. Good songs (and they are songs), mixing up some REM/Smiths vocals among reverb, tremolo, turntables, percussion, endless bass, and a sound that points right at the crossover of post-indie-punk-whatever of the late ’80s and electronica (the post-indie-punk-whatever of the late ’90s). With enough money, they can easily be pushed toward the penultimate top o’ the heap. Not the top, mind you, but close.
